Bing maps 如何在Openlayers上以低于最大缩放的分辨率渲染Bing贴图分幅

Bing maps 如何在Openlayers上以低于最大缩放的分辨率渲染Bing贴图分幅,bing-maps,openlayers-3,Bing Maps,Openlayers 3,我有一张openlayers3地图,可以从Bing地图加载空中瓷砖 当缩放超过一定量时,平铺将替换为带有无图像图标的白色平铺 我需要允许用户放大这个级别,这样他们就可以看到矢量特征在地图上的位置 我想有openlayers或Bing放大到现有的图像,即使分辨率不好,它比白色瓷砖更好 我能找到的最接近的信息是用户提出的另一个问题:457052。它可能适用于openlayers2。您需要在ol.source.BingMaps中设置maxZoom默认情况下,它将设置为世界某些地区存在数据的最大级别。

我有一张openlayers3地图,可以从Bing地图加载空中瓷砖

当缩放超过一定量时,平铺将替换为带有无图像图标的白色平铺

我需要允许用户放大这个级别,这样他们就可以看到矢量特征在地图上的位置

我想有openlayers或Bing放大到现有的图像,即使分辨率不好,它比白色瓷砖更好


我能找到的最接近的信息是用户提出的另一个问题:457052。它可能适用于openlayers2。

您需要在ol.source.BingMaps中设置maxZoom默认情况下,它将设置为世界某些地区存在数据的最大级别。找到在您所在地区有效的最高级别(英国为19),并将其限制在该级别。

谢谢。我很惊讶这能起作用,因为我的ol.source.BingMaps文档没有提到可以应用maxZoom,或者它可以缩放瓷砖。这是BingMaps V8的新功能。还演示了如何使用map.getTargetZoom()动态获取给定视图或区域的maxZoom。是的,这将有助于它在主文档中解释它的用途,您将在其中一个示例中找到唯一有用的说明